New IACUC Policy on Noncompliance

September 8, 2016

blue new policy iconIn an effort to minimize and eliminate issues of non-compliance, the Institutional Animal Care & Use Committee (IACUC) is instituting a new Investigating Noncompliance and Animal Welfare Concerns Policy effective October 1, 2016.

All Principal Investigators with previous incidents will be given a "clean slate" upon the policy's implementation.

About the Policy

As part of the new policy, a combination of tactics, including but not limited to: formal notices, training, and (when necessary) punitive measures will be used to mitigate incidents of noncompliance. Actions taken to minimize occurrences of noncompliance will be based on:

  • The seriousness of the incident and/or
  • The number of incidents that occur on all protocols under the direction of the PI

The cornerstone of this policy is a program-wide commitment to transparency through more clearly defined roles/responsibilities and a three-step corrective action escalation process pertaining to the investigation, and confirmation of, noncompliance and animal welfare concerns reported within our research community.
